A gas explosion at a coal mine in northern China killed at least 82 people, state media said on Saturday, in one of the country’s most devastating industrial disasters in recent years. According to Xinhua, the blast occurred around 7:29 p.m. (1129 GMT) on Friday at the Liushenyu coal mine in Shanxi province. According to Xinhua, a total of 247 personnel were underground at the time, with the majority having been hauled to the surface by Saturday morning. The Oyo State Government has suspended all school excursions, field trips, sports competitions, and other activities outside of school grounds as burial rites for slain teacher Adesiyan Adegboye begins. The move by the state government follows last week’s deadly coordinated abduction attack on schools in the Oriire Local Government Area. Adegboye, 49, one of the teachers slain in the attack, lay in state on Friday at Ayegun Baptist Church in Ogbomoso before being buried later that day at his home in the Owolake district of town. Real Madrid head coach Alvaro Arbeloa has stated that he will depart the club at the end of the season, with Jose Mourinho poised to take over. The 43-year-old was promoted from his post as Real Madrid B manager in January, replacing former Liverpool teammate Xabi Alonso, and will now leave the club following a trophyless season. Mourinho, who has been in charge of Benfica this season, is in final talks to take over at Real Madrid, having previously managed the club from 2010 to 2013.
